Church Partnerships – Lutheran Church of the Cross

Church Partnership – Lutheran Church of the Cross Lutheran Church of the Cross (LCC) has been a strong supporter of Blessman International for over two decades. In 2002, LCC sponsored its first trip to Mexico with Blessman International (then called Blessman Medical Ministries), the first of many trips. Pit Toilet Drownings

Venda Pit Toilet Drowning On December 6th another child drowned in a pit toilet in South Africa. This time it occurred in the Venda tribal area of Limpopo.
